The Creamy Cheesecake Foundation
At the heart of every great cheesecake is, well, the cheesecake itself! A smooth, rich, and utterly decadent filling is key. Typically, this involves cream cheese, sugar, eggs, and a touch of vanilla. The quality of your cream cheese makes a huge difference, so opt for full-fat, brick-style cream cheese for the best results. Don’t skimp!

The Buttery Graham Cracker Crust
The crust provides the perfect counterpoint to the creamy filling. A classic graham cracker crust is easy to make and provides a satisfying crunch. We’re talking gra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and a little sugar, pressed firmly into the bottom of your springform pan. Pre-baking the crust helps it stay crisp and prevents it from getting soggy.

The Star of the Show: Strawberry Crunch Topping
This is where the Strawberry Crunch Cheesecake really shines! The topping is a delightful combination of crushed Golden Oreos (or similar vanilla wafers), freeze-dried strawberries, melted butter, and sometimes a little powdered sugar. The freeze-dried strawberries provide an intense strawberry flavor and a beautiful pop of color. The resulting crunch is addictive!
Here’s a breakdown of the crunch elements:
- Crushed Cookies: Golden Oreos offer a subtle vanilla flavor and a satisfying crunch.
- Freeze-Dried Strawberries: These provide concentrated strawberry flavor and a vibrant pink hue.
- Melted Butter: Binds the ingredients together and adds a rich, buttery flavor.

Tips for Strawberry Crunch Cheesecake Success
Baking a cheesecake can seem intimidating, but with a few simple tips, you can achieve cheesecake perfection. Here are a few things to keep in mind:
-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ure your cream cheese, eggs, and any other dairy are at room temperature. This helps them blend smoothly and prevents lumps.
- Don’t Overmix: Overmixing incorporates too much air into the batter, which can cause cracks. Mix until just combined.
- Water Bath (Optional, but Recommended): Baking the cheesecake in a water bath helps it bake evenly and prevents cracking. Wrap the bottom of your springform pan in foil to prevent water from seeping in.
- Cooling Process: Let the cheesecake cool gradually in the oven with the door slightly ajar. This prevents drastic temperature changes that can cause cracking.
- Chill Time: Refrigerate the cheesecake for at least 6 hours, or preferably overnight, before slicing and serving. This allows the flavors to meld and the cheesecake to set properly.

Serving and Storing Your Masterpiece
Once your Strawberry Crunch Cheesecake is chilled and ready to go, it’s time to slice and serve! A warm, sharp knife will make clean cuts. Garnish with fresh strawberries or a dusting of powdered sugar for an extra touch.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Keep it covered to prevent it from drying out.
